Valproate as a risk factor for lamotrigine discontinuation
Yasuhisa Abe1, Setsuko Yasugawa, Kenshiro Miyamoto
1Yatsushiro Kousei Hospital, Kumamoto, Japan.
Combining lamotrigine with valproate increases the risk of discontinuing lamotrigine treatment in bipolar depression patients. This combination therapy may hinder treatment continuation due to adverse effects.

Background:
- Lamotrigine is a potential treatment for bipolar depression.
- Adverse effects can limit lamotrigine treatment continuation.
- Identifying risk factors for discontinuation is crucial.
Purpose of the Study:
- To identify risk factors for lamotrigine discontinuation.
- To analyze factors potentially interacting with lamotrigine treatment outcomes.
Main Methods:
- Retrospective observational study.
- Comparison of patients discontinuing lamotrigine within 2 months versus those maintaining treatment for over 2 months.
- Multiple regression analysis to identify significant associations.
Main Results:
- Valproate combination therapy was significantly associated with lamotrigine discontinuation.
- This association remained significant after adjusting for other factors.
Conclusions:
- Lamotrigine and valproate combination treatment may lead to treatment discontinuation.
- Further research with larger sample sizes is warranted due to study limitations.
